You all probably remember remainders from primary school maths:
if you divide 17 by 5 then 5 goes into 17 three times with a remainder of 2.
We can do so-called integer division (which is written using a \ rather than the usual / division symbol): this is where we throw away the remainder. So 17 \ 5 = 3. Geddit?
